/**
* @deprecated
* Lookup the three character country code for a given IP address.
*
* @note This native will overflow the buffer by one cell on an unknown ip lookup!
* @note Use geoip_code3_ex instead!
*
* @param ip The IP address to lookup.
* @param result The result buffer.
*/
native geoip_code3(const ip[], result[4]);
Синтаксис:
geoip_code3 ( ip[], ccode[4] )
- ip[] - ip игрока
- ccode[4] - Массив для записи кода страны
Тип функции:
Native
Пример:
/* Plugin generated by AMXX-Studio */
#include <amxmodx>
#include <amxmisc>
#include <geoip>
#define PLUGIN "[geoip.inc] geoip_code3"
#define VERSION "1.0"
#define AUTHOR "Admin"
public plugin_init() {
register_plugin(PLUGIN, VERSION, AUTHOR)
register_clcmd("say /get_country","country")
register_clcmd("say /gc","country")
}
public country(id){
new ip[18]
get_user_ip(id,ip,17,1)
new code[4]
geoip_code3 ( ip, code)
client_print(id,print_chat,"Code3: %s",code)
}
Описание:
Функция полностью аналогична функции geoip_code2.
По этому если вам не совсем понятно как все это работает, прочитайте описание для geoip_code2.
А я позволю себе дать слабину и не писать тут одинаковое описание с другой функцией.